Biography

Researcher in the project SENSING IBERIANSCAPES, leaded by Carmen Cuenca. She graduated in History and Heritage in the UJI in 2022 and did her master in archaeology in the UV in 2023.
She has participated in multiple field work in the last years, in the archaeological sites in Borriana of Villa Romana de Sant Gregori, Molì de l’Arròs and Torrucles. She also participated in the activities in the Archaeological museum of the municipality. Moreover, she participated in the 76th archaeological course in Empúries.
Her area is the study, conservation, and diffusion of rural heritage. She promotes the analysis of the agriculture and animal husbandry medium as a way to understand the transformations of the landscape and its historical, cultural, social and economic implications.
The approximation from archaeological methods to this field is one of her academic interest. Specifically, her master’s thesis was centred in the study of the cultural heritage related to husbandry movements in Ares del Maestrat. In this work, one of the key points was the photogrammetric analysis of dry-stone huts in this municipality.
